1792 - Kentucky became the 15th state.

1796 - Tennessee became the 16th state.

What I find interesting here is how fast the western frontier was expanding at that early time.

1813 - Capt. James Lawrence, the mortally wounded commander of the frigate Chesapeake, said "Don't give up the ship." He died three days later.
